Question 581621: Write a function C(x) for cost of x sweatshirts. The sweatshirts cost $7.50 each. The paint costs 14.75. Determine the cost of three sweatshirts.

C(x) = 7.5x + 14.75
C(3) = 7.5(3) + 14.75
C(3) = 22.5 + 14.75
C(3) = 37.25
So 3 shirts cost $37.25
